Retype 100 Pages into Word
Budget: $250 – $750 USD
I have around 100 xeroxed pages of type-written notes that need to be transformed into a clean, editable digital file. The final deliverable must be a single MS Word document laid out with standard, reader-friendly formatting—clear headings, consistent sub-headings, and bullet points where they logically fit.
To keep the content true to the source, accuracy is critical. I expect every line retyped, spell-checked, and lightly proof-read so the text is publication-ready without the blurred edges or spacing issues common in photocopies. Where the original uses underlining or capitalization for emphasis, please apply the closest Word styling (bold or italics) so key concepts still stand out.
Deliverables:
• Fully retyped 100-page .docx file, formatted with standard headings and bullet lists.
• Pagination that mirrors the original page order.
• A brief change log noting any illegible words you had to clarify or flag.
No OCR shortcuts, please—the original copies have uneven print that software typically misreads. A careful, manual approach will ensure the notes remain clear and accurate.
